New York 2023-2024 Regular Session

New York Senate Bill S04320

Introduced
2/7/23  
Refer
2/7/23  

Caption

Requires persons against whom an order of protection is issued to wear an electronic monitoring device; prohibits the tampering with such a device and violation of such prohibition constitutes a class E felony.
